Silver Creek Board election shows few changes
Results in the Service Area 3 Board of Trustees election showed Brad Iverson, the incumbent of the Upper District, beating write-in candidate Michael Montgomery 66 votes to 43.
For the Lower District, which had two vacancies, Betty Bauwens, an incumbent, and Marcello Occon, a write-in candidate, secured the two seats on the Board with 111 and 107 votes, respectively. Eileen Galoostian had 41 votes and Len Bowes finished with 35. Bauwens currently serves as clerk on the Board.
